www.brickmoonmedia.comIn 1869, a 200-foot brick sphere was hurled into Earth’s orbit in Edward Everett Hale’s story, “The Brick Moon.” The moon, made of 12 million bricks, was meant to be a navigational aid for sailors, but what it represented was a vision of a future where everyone is connected by artificial satellite. To us, the brick moon is our North Star, a constant reminder that when we lead with imagination, we can accomplish anything. We are Brick Moon, a highly niche marketing partner built to do one thing and nothing else: Help your brand grow by winning a world of new customers through satellite radio.
